Transaction 87527106ca2910205151496df6621cb425903728a9aad99f431665741dc14051
1 Input
1 Output
-
87527106ca2910205151496df6621cb425903728a9aad99f431665741dc14051:0
- value
- 1148933
- script pubkey
- OP_0 OP_PUSHBYTES_20 6ea5ad7676b90ca56f947fef8bb295ffeb05bec6
- address
- bc1qd6j66ankhyx22mu50lhchv54ll4st0kxs9dqpn